Pantellerite is a peralkaline rhyolite. It has a higher iron and lower aluminium composition than comendite  
Monzonite is a granular igneous rock with composition between syenite and diorite and containing approximately equal amounts of orthoclase and plagioclase

From Pantelleria, a volcanic island in the Strait of Sicily  
From Mount Monzoni in the Tyrol, Italy, + -ite1
